Job Description
Join our dynamic team at The Fitzgerald, our newest community, as a Memory Care Director. The Memory Care Director promotes a healthy and actively-enriched lifestyle within the memory care community.
What will I do every day?
Monitor residents and evaluate residents regularly and assess levels of care
Effectively supervise departmental operations on a day-to-day basis under the guidance of the Executive Director
Plan and prepare assignment sheets for resident assistants
Responsible for overall administration and management of the Alzheimer’s residential area
Actively support and facilitate wellness programs that meet the needs of each resident
Respond in a tactful and timely manner to all concerns placed by residents, family members
Supervise medication programs
Interface with physicians and other care providers
Monitor all physician orders and ensure they have been followed
Maintain contact with outside health care services pertaining to the resident’s needs
Observe, report and document residents’ services and requirements at each shift
Oversee medication control and coordinate with physicians for optimum health care
Handle emergency situations responsibly and calmly until aid arrives
Conduct and/or assist with regular staff meetings and daily stand-ups
Review payroll documentation to minimize missed punches and monitor overtime
What will I need to be successful in this role?
A passion for excellence
Be a great team player
Be a progressive and creative thinker
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N), or have a bachelor’s degree in health services/social sciences or related field
Three to five years’ experience working in senior care management, with a preference for experience working with persons living with dementia
Special Requirements/Certifications I may need?
Must have or be able to obtain the appropriate state license required by law
CPR Certified
